The St John's wort‐containing herbal medicinal products in clinical use contain widely differing amounts of hypericin and hyperforin, even after correcting for differences in the amount of extract per dose. In 2003, researchers who tested 54 commercial St. Johns wort products purchased in Canada and the United States reported that only two products had a total hypericin content (hypericin plus pseudohypericin) within 10% of the amount stated on the label. St John’s wort (hypericum perforatum) poisoning in horses is a toxicity which occurs as a result of the equine consuming the weed which contains hypericin, a chemical known to cause photosensitization in horses, sheep, cattle and goats. Phototoxic photosensitivity from hypericum preparations appears to be due to the naphthodianthrones, hypericin, and pseudohypericin.
